Today's felines are part of the fissipid carnivores, seven families located almost all over the world.

Felids are made up of various genera, which differ according to the author of the classification.

Leyhausen

In this type of classification the genus "felis" includes several species, which do not include the "felis cattus", that is the common domestic cat, which is considered to belong to the genus "felis silvestris"

Hemmer

According to this classification, five species can be considered:

Felis nigripes black-footed cat.

Felis margarita sand cat

Felis chaus jungle cat

Felis bieti desert cat

Felis silvestris wild cat
